Three houses are available in a locality. Three persons apply for the houses. Each applies for one houses without consulting others. The probability that all three apply for the same houses is `1//9` b. `2//9` c. `7//9` d. `8//9`

Required probability = `("No. of favorable cases")/("Total no. of exhaustive cases")`
= `(3)/(3xx3xx3) = (1)/(9)`
